Online Presence For Contractors: A Basic Guide to Setting Up
So, you’re a professional and understand that having a website is now vital for attracting new clients. Don't feel intimidated ! Creating a basic site doesn’t have to be complicated. There are several affordable options available, even if you’re not a digital whiz. You can choose from DIY website builders like Wix or Squarespace which offer easy intuitive design features , allowing you to build a professional looking platform in no time. Alternatively, consider working with a freelancer on sites like Upwork or Fiverr; they can create a custom website tailored to your specific services. Here’s a quick rundown:
- Define Your Goals: What do you want your website to do?
- Choose A Domain Name: This is your online identity.
- Design a Simple Layout: Keep it clean and easy to navigate .
- Display Your Services: Clearly explain what you provide .
- Add Testimonials: Positive feedback builds credibility.
Remember, the goal is to be found by potential patrons searching for your expertise online. A simple, functional website is a fantastic starting point !

Effective Tradesperson Website Features
A top-notch tradie website absolutely requires several important features to really attract customers. Firstly , a mobile-responsive structure is absolutely critical - most potential clients will be searching on their phones . Secondly, clearly displayed business information, including a prominent contact form and multiple ways to get in touch , is vital. Furthermore , showcasing your work with a portfolio of high-quality photos or videos can be incredibly persuasive . Don’t forget an area for testimonials ; positive feedback builds reputation. Finally, easy navigation and fast performance are indispensable to keeping visitors on your site.
